SUTERA v. SULLY BUTTES BD. OF EDUC.

No. 14423.

351 N.W.2d 457 (1984)

Daniel L. SUTERA, Plaintiff and Appellee, v. SULLY BUTTES BOARD OF EDUCATION, Sully Buttes School District No. 58-2, Brian Meyer, Tony Todd, Cliff De Sautell, Lillian Dampbell, Cathy Davis, Leonda Wright, and Don Burgeson, Defendants and Appellants.

Supreme Court of South Dakota.

Decided July 11, 1984.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Linda Lea Viken of Finch & Viken, Rapid City, for plaintiff and appellee.

Charles M. Thompson of May, Adam, Gerdes & Thompson, Pierre, for defendants and appellants; Patricia A. Meyers of May, Adam, Gerdes & Thompson, Pierre, on the brief.


DUNN, Justice.

This is an appeal from a judgment of the trial court which reversed a school board decision and reinstated a tenured teacher to employment. We affirm.

Daniel L. Sutera was a teacher in the Sully Buttes School System for thirteen years, during which time he attained tenured status. Sutera taught social sciences, driver's education, physical education, and had coaching responsibilities every year.
